如何要求用户输入一个数字然后让程序加到从2开始的输入?

时间:2016-11-29 19:27:12

标签: python python-3.x

您好我想知道如何要求用户输入一个数字,然后让程序加起来从2开始的输入。我目前正在使用python 3.0。关于我希望它如何看待的例子:

用户输入= 10 清单:[2,3,4,5,6,7,8,9,10]

1 个答案:

答案 0 :(得分:0)

一个非常简单的解决方案。

#!/usr/bin/env python3

def ask_num():
    list_of_num = []
    num = input("Enter integer number: ")
    try:
        num = int(num)
        for num in range(2, num + 1):
            list_of_num.append(num)
    except ValueError as e:
        print("You did not enter a integer.")
    print(list_of_num)
ask_num()